It was a good run, but  Warner unfortunately witnessed the end of their  11-match winning streak on Saturday. They fell  2-0 to the Miller Rustlers. Unfortunately, that's the third time they've come up short against the Rustlers this season,  with their most recent  loss being a  2-1  defeat  back in September.
Warner's offense was headlined by  Jaycee Jung and  MaKenna Leidholt, who picked up five kills apiece. They got some help from  Reagan Wood and her seven assists.
Warner's defeat dropped their record down to 25-6. As for Miller, the  victory was  the sixth in a row for them, bringing their record up to 19-7.
